Becoming a member of WTTC Baltimore means joining a diverse group of people who enjoy getting together once a month for a mid-week dinner and to learn something new. Our guest speakers cover topics that range from cool facts about our local environment and economy, to industry market updates, to personal growth and development, to Supply-Chain-specific continuous education and so much more.

We like to have raffles and door prizes, we love celebrating people and holidays and we have multiple charity drives throughout the year, to benefit our local communities in need.

Our Mission

Our Mission is to unite the people engaged exclusively or partially in traffic duties of the various commercial and transportation interests of Baltimore and the vicinity in a program of education. We provide opportunities to network and to create relationships and understanding between those involved in the transportation industry.

Our membership base is also involved in other professional organizations that apply specifically to their career track. In the spirit of community and support, the Women's Traffic and Transportation Club, Inc. promotes the events of these organizations and participates as a group in many of their functions.

We also have members who spend their free time giving back to the community. We do our best to support these events with our presence and/or donations.
